Amit Agarwal & ORS v. State Of West Bengal & ANR
24.06.2024 Sl.No. 26 Ct. 32 Amalranjan In The High Court At Calcutta Criminal Revisional Jurisdiction Appellate Side CRR 1805 of 2017 Sri Amit Agarwal and ors.
Vs.
The State of West Bengal and anr.
Nobody appears on behalf of either of the parties on call. Even on earlier occasion no one represented the petitioners, no accommodation sought.
This is an application pending since 2017.
Upon perusal of the record it appears that the petitioners have obtained stay order from this court. At the time of passing interim order, the petitioners were directed to serve the revisional application along with the copy of the order upon the opposite parties within a week from date and to file affidavit of service to such effect on the next date of hearing.
In spite of such direction, no one appears to show that the copy has been served upon the opposite parties. Under such circumstances, this court finds that the petitioners are no more interested to proceed with the instant case.
Accordingly, CRR 1805 of 2017 is dismissed as nonprosecution. Interim order, if any, stands vacated.
Let the order be communicated to the Ld. Court below for information.
Liberty is granted to all parties to act in terms of the copy of this order downloaded from the official website of this court.
